UK Government Eyes Intervention in Telegraph Sale

Quick Summary#

The British government is reportedly preparing to intervene in a major media transaction that could fundamentally alter the UK's political discourse. A proposed £500 million acquisition of the conservative-leaning The Telegraph by the owner of the Daily Mail has drawn official scrutiny.

This potential intervention signals growing concern over media plurality and the concentration of influential voices. The deal, if completed, would consolidate significant conservative media power under a single ownership group, prompting regulatory questions about its impact on the democratic landscape.

The Proposed Acquisition#

In November 2025, the owner of the Daily Mail announced a landmark agreement to purchase The Telegraph for £500 million. This transaction represents a significant consolidation within the British media sector, bringing two of the country's most prominent conservative publications under common ownership.

The acquisition is not merely a financial transaction but a strategic move that would reshape the media landscape. By combining the reach and influence of these two established titles, the deal aims to create a formidable platform for conservative commentary and news.

The scale of this potential merger has attracted immediate attention from regulatory bodies. The concentration of media ownership is a sensitive issue in the UK, where maintaining a diverse range of voices is considered essential for a healthy democracy.

Government Scrutiny#

The British government is now considering whether to intervene in the transaction, a move that could delay or even block the sale. Regulatory intervention typically occurs when a merger is deemed to threaten competition or plurality in the media sector.

Government officials are likely examining the deal's potential impact on the diversity of news and opinion available to the public. The concentration of two major conservative outlets under single ownership could reduce the range of perspectives in the UK's media ecosystem.

The decision to intervene carries significant political weight. The government must balance the principles of free market competition with the need to protect democratic institutions from undue influence.
